Jharkhand News: IIT ISM Dhanbad director exhorts scholars to research in interdisciplinary areas

Director inaugurates orientation program

SUBHASH MISHRA

 

Dhanbad, July 16: IIT ISM Dhanbad director Prof Sukumar Mishra called upon the  PhD students to carry out, research in Interdisciplinary areas to excel and achieve the goals.

Orientation of newly enrolled PhD scholars

Prof Mishra, who was addressing the orientation programme of newly enrolled PhD scholars at Penman Auditorium of IIT (ISM) today, advised them to develop good interpersonal relations with everyone, right from roommates to lab mates, faculty members and staff.

“The quality of research at the institute and its acceptability among people helps in perception building for any institute,” the director said.

A total of 332 research scholars out of 347 attended the orientation programme and got details about the legacy, facilities, infrastructure, high-tech labs and others of the institute.

Professors brief students about institute and curriculum 

Prof Rajni Singh, dean of corporate communications of the institute gave details of the existing infrastructure and facilities of IIT ISM.

Prof MK Singh, dean academic, in his address asked the research scholars it is time to do hard work with patience as it requires continuous and consistent effort to complete the course successfully.

Prof SK Gupta, dean, students welfare gave details of the sporting facilities and cultural and sporting activities organized throughout the year. He emphasized on the need to maintain good health by engaging in sporting activities to excel in life and career.

Prof Sagar Pal, dean of research and development, in his address gave details of the research and development infrastructure at the institute.

Prof Amit Dixit, dean (infrastructure) gave details of existing infrastructure as well the upcoming facilities.

Dr Ajay Mandal, the professor in charge library, informed about the existing books, journal stocks, book borrowing facilities, reading rooms, cafeteria etc.
